Abstract
PURPOSE: To evaluate factors associated with survival following transarterial 90Y (yttrium) radioembolization (TARE) in patients with advanced intrahepatic cholangiocarcinoma (ICC).Entities:
Keywords: Y-90 Yttrium; intrahepatic cholangiocarcinoma; radioembolization

Figure 1Kaplan–Meier Analysis of survival after 90Y TARE. (A) Increased cumulative survival of patients with unilobar (n = 17) versus bilobar (n = 29) disease (p = 0.042). (B) Increased survival of patients without previous resective surgery (n = 28) compared to patients who have undergone previous resection (n = 9, p = 0.002); a total of n = 37 patients with sufficient follow-up data were included in the analysis. (C) Previous systemic therapy missed statistical significance as a prognostic factor in this cohort of patients.
